Title
Gift by Henry son of Margery of Carsington to William de Hopton of Carsington, of ½ acre arable in le Domefeld, between the land of William de Hopton and Ralf de Alsop. Witnesses; Robert de Middleton, Robert de Alsop, Henry de Alsop (all of Carsington), Simon son of Henry de Hopton, Richard de Cromford, Robert de Callow, William de Balldion etc
Dated at Carsington, Sunday after St Mark [30 Apr]
Date
1314
